Sunnyvale athlete plays in TicketCity Bowl

Freshman OL Emeka Okafor who graduated from Sunnyvale HS plays for the University of Houston.  He was on the field for all field goal and point after attempts for the Cougars.  Okafor is the first athlete from Sunnyvale to earn a full scholarship.

Keenum breaks records while dispatching Penn State

Houston quarterback Case Keenum set an all time NCAA bowl record by passing for 227 yards in the first quarter of the 2012 TicketCity Bowl.  Keenum finished the game 45 of 69 for 532 passing yards and 3 TDs in the Cougars 30-14 win over Penn State.  Keenum, who was named Most Valuable Player, also set 4 Cotton Bowl Stadium records for most plays, most passing yards, most attempts and completions.

BYU takes Bell Helicopter Armed Forces Bowl

BYU players pose with the Bell Helicopter Armed Forces Bowl trophy
Tulsa played well enough to win the Bell Helicopter Armed Forces Bowl if the game was two 29 minute halves.  Tulsa had a 14-3 lead with less than a minute to go in the first half when they muffed a punt that allowed BYU to score and cut the lead to 14-10 at halftime.  Leading 21-17 with 4:18 remaining in the game, Tulsa punted to BYU who took over at the Tulsa 47.  BYU quarterback Riley Nelson led the Cougars down the field and hit BYU game Most Outstanding Player Cody Hoffman for a 2yd TD pass with only 11 seconds remaining.  Hoffman finished the game with 8 catches, 122 receiving yards and 3 TDs.
